5. Plastic Storage Bags for Long-Term Preservation

If you’re not displaying your plushies year-round or need a long-term storage solution, plastic storage bags can help protect your plush toys from dust, moisture, and insects. For plushies you plan to store in an attic or closet, vacuum-sealed bags are great for saving space while preserving your plushies.

  • Tip: Use plastic storage bags only for plushies you don’t need to access regularly, as they aren’t ideal for frequent opening and closing.
  • Bonus: Add a dryer sheet inside the bag to keep your plushies smelling fresh.

FAQs About Plushie Storage

Q: How can I keep my plushies dust-free?

  • A: If you’re not using closed storage, like bins or cabinets, make sure to regularly dust or vacuum your plushies to keep them clean. You can also store plushies in transparent bags for long-term storage to keep them dust-free.

Q: How should I store plushies when not in use?

  • A: For long-term storage, use plastic storage bags or vacuum-sealed bags to protect plushies from dust, moisture, and pests. Make sure the bags are clean and dry before storing.

Q: Can I store plushies in the attic or basement?

  • A: You can, but be cautious about humidity and temperature fluctuations. Always use airtight containers or vacuum-sealed bags to protect plushies from mold, mildew, and pests.

Q: How do I store giant plushies?

  • A: For giant plushies like Giant Dream Dragon Plushie, consider large storage bins or keep them displayed in a designated corner of the room. Alternatively, vacuum-sealed bags can help compress larger plushies for easier storage.
